Форум программистов, компьютерный форум, киберфорум
Pascal (Паскаль)
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
Pascal while Помогите пожалуйста написать программу, которая вычисляет сумму, произведение и средне арифметическое последовательности чисел вводимых пользователем с клавиатуры заканчивающихся нулем. Выполнить с помощью оператора While. https://www.cyberforum.ru/ pascal/ thread56294.html Теорема о промежуточном строении Pascal
Столкнулся с проблемой! Не могу придумать программу на Теорему о промежуточном значении непрерывной функции. Теорема записана в тетради, и надо сделать её в паскале. Сама теорема: Пусть f непрерывна на . f(a)*f(b)<0 тогда существует корень на промежутке (a;b): f(c)=0, где "с" это и есть корень. Доказывается она таким образом => Промежуток (a;b) делится на 2, получаем число. Далее если...
Pascal Вычислить сумму ряда и определить количество его элементов. Помогите вычислить сумму ряда. Здравствуйте. С Pascal я познакомился совсем недавно, сразу возник вопрос по одной из задач, кто знает, подскажите, пожалуйста. -Используя рекуррентную формулу, вычислить сумму ряда http://s45.***********/i108/0910/c5/b7aa8c61d748.gif С точностью 1) E=0,01; 2)E=0,001. Определить количество элементов ряда, включенных в сумму. Примечание. Сумма ряда сходиться... https://www.cyberforum.ru/ pascal/ thread56288.html Pascal неверное выражение в if https://www.cyberforum.ru/ pascal/ thread56285.html
program gradusov; const n=3; var s,i,j,m,r:integer; a:array of integer; begin r:=0; for i:= 1 to n do for j:=1to n do begin readln(a);
Pascal k-тая цифра справа
Используя процедуру (функцию) определения последней цифры некоторого натурального числа, найдите k-тую справа цифру натурального числа n. Например, пятая справа цифра числа 38940284 равна 4.
Pascal Массивы процедуры и фунукции https://www.cyberforum.ru/ pascal/ thread56271.html
Составьте программы для решения следующих задач, используя обращение к процедуре и функции. Данные массивы X(8), Y(8), Z(10), W(15), элементы которых определяются за формулами xi=a1i2-a2(5-i); yi=b1sin(2i)+b2ei-5; zi=c1(і-4)+c2sin2(1,5i); wi=d1ln(0,1i)+d2cos3(і-2,5). a1=2 a2=10 b1=4 b2=6 c1=8 c2=3 d1=5 d2=12 Сформируйте массив из разниц между суммами...
Pascal Символы https://www.cyberforum.ru/ pascal/ thread56259.html
Предложение описано символьной переменной заданной длиной. Определить, встречается ли запятая?
Record Pascal
Помогите плизз, реализовать программу, которая: "Спрашивает у пользователя одно комплексное число в алгебраической форме. На выбор пользователя множит или делит на заданное целое число"
Pascal Массивы в Pascal Всем привет. Помогите чайнику! Пожалуйста! Нужно перемножить две матрицы. Размерности например 100 на 100 и 100 на 200 ( хотя это не так важно)! Решите пожалуйста в паскале. И, если можно, наиболее просто и понятно! Заранее спасибо! https://www.cyberforum.ru/ pascal/ thread56250.html Pascal Прога в паскале недописанная https://www.cyberforum.ru/ pascal/ thread56249.html
решаю задачку...в паскале.....не могу правильно вписать цикл..... {prog03.pas ProGramma reshaet sledushuy zadachu: Dani haturalnie chisla N i M(0<=m<=9).Naiti chislo vhoshdeniy M v chislo N. Avtor:Trefilova I.A.,gr.39-11 Data:23.09.2009} program PROG03; uses crt; var n,m,f:integer;
поиска Max и min Pascal
Прирешение задач столкнулся с такой вот задачаей: разработать программу для отыскания max(min(a,b),Min(c,d)), не используя сложные лгические условия и вложенные ветвления. числа a,b,c,d-целые. вот такая задача..я встал на ней и впал в ступор...помогие пожалуста решить
Pascal подсчет количества цифр собственно текст задачи: Первая и вторая строки входного файла(можно вводить с клавиатуры, а не файлом) содержат начало и конец промежутка времени. Начальное время не превосходит конечное. Время задается в формате hh:mm:ss (0<=hh<24; 0<=mm<60; 0<=ss<60). Числа дополнены по необходимости нулями. Необходимо вывести 10 строк, в i-ой строке должно быть прописано, сколько раз встречается цифра ( i -1... https://www.cyberforum.ru/ pascal/ thread56242.html
Почетный модератор
64304 / 47599 / 32743
Регистрация: 18.05.2008
Сообщений: 115,181
14.10.2009, 08:51 0

Использование рекурсии - Pascal - Ответ 304967

14.10.2009, 08:51. Показов 1243. Ответов 1
Метки (Все метки)

Лучший ответ Сообщение было отмечено marcus:D как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
uses crt;
function MyDiv(a,b:integer):integer;
begin
if b=a then MyDiv:=1
else if b>a then MyDiv:=0
else MyDiv:=MyDiv(a-b,b)+MyDiv(a,a);
end;
function MyMod(a,b:integer):integer;
begin
if b=a then MyMod:=0
else if b>a then MyMod:=a
else MyMod:=Mymod(a-b,b);
end;
var m,n:integer;
    c,o:integer;
begin
clrscr;
write('m=');readln(m);
write('n=');readln(n);
writeln('Частное=',Mydiv(m,n));
write('Oстаток=',MyMod(m,n));
readln
end.


Вернуться к обсуждению:
Использование рекурсии Pascal
1
Заказать работу у эксперта

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
14.10.2009, 08:51
Готовые ответы и решения:

Выход из рекурсии
Я не пойму где у меня осуществляется выход из рекурсии (код писал сам), а на каком месте/условии...

Массивы и рекурсии
Дан целочисленный массив из 50 элементов, требуется определить наименьшее значение массива, а затем...

Написание рекурсии
Ребята помогите пожалуйста! Задумал процедурку написать которая в соотвествии с некоторой строкой...

Ошибка в реализации рекурсии
Здравствуйте, подскажите пожалуйста в чём ошибка. &quot;Неверное число параметров функции&quot; выдает в 4...

1
14.10.2009, 08:51
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
14.10.2009, 08:51
Помогаю со студенческими работами здесь

табуляция из заданной рекурсии
составить программу табуляции функции, заданною рекурсивной функцией f(0)=1, f(1)=3,...

Методом дихотомии в рекурсии
Помогите написать код: с погрешностью 0.001 уточнить методом дихотомии корень уравнения x*x*x -...

Обосновать применение рекурсии
дана задача, и ответ, в который нужно вписать рекурсивную процедуру возвращения указателя на...

Задача с использованием рекурсии
Очень срочно, заранее благодарю:) sqrt{11-2\sqrt{11+2\sqrt{11-2\sqrt{11-2\sqrt{11+...}}}}}

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ru